In 2018, the Philippine vaping scene was characterized by a surge in organized events, each catering to different aspects of vaping culture. One of the most significant events was the Philippine Vape Convention held in Manila. This annual convention has become a cornerstone for industry stakeholders, bringing together manufacturers, retailers, and enthusiasts under one roof. It featured a diverse range of exhibitors showcasing the latest products and technologies in the vaping industry.
Attendees at the convention participated in informative seminars led by industry experts, covering topics such as the science behind vaping, health implications, and advancements in vape technology. These seminars aimed to equip both new and seasoned vapers with crucial knowledge to make informed decisions. Furthermore, the event provided a platform for networking, allowing businesses to forge partnerships and expand their reach within the growing market.
Another notable event was the Vape Expo Philippines, which focused on bringing international and local brands together. This expo showcased a variety of e-liquids, devices, and accessories, all while emphasizing the importance of quality and safety standards in the industry. The presence of international brands highlighted the Philippines as an emerging hub for vaping, attracting attention from global players eager to tap into the local market.
Importantly, 2018 also saw events aimed at advocacy and awareness. Organizations such as the Vaporized Philippines spearheaded campaigns to educate the public regarding vaping versus smoking. Stands at various fairs and community events raised awareness about vaping as a reduced-risk alternative to smoking, promoting it as a less harmful lifestyle choice. This advocacy was crucial in shaping public perception and countering stigma associated with vaping.
